Subject: [PATCH 11/15] ice: add board identifier info to devlink .info_get
Date: Thu, 30 Jan 2020 14:59:06 -0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200130225913.1671982-12-jacob.e.keller@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200130225913.1671982-1-jacob.e.keller@intel.com>

Export a unique board identifier using "board.id" for devlink's
.info_get command.

Obtain this by reading the NVM for the PBA identification string.

+/**
+ * ice_read_pba_string - Reads part number string from NVM
+ * @hw: pointer to hardware structure
+ * @pba_num: stores the part number string from the NVM
+ * @pba_num_size: part number string buffer length
+ *
+ * Reads the part number string from the NVM.
+ */
+enum ice_status
+ice_read_pba_string(struct ice_hw *hw, u8 *pba_num, u32 pba_num_size)
+{
+	u16 pba_tlv, pba_tlv_len;
+	enum ice_status status;
+	u16 pba_word, pba_size;
+	u16 i;
+
+	status = ice_get_pfa_module_tlv(hw, &pba_tlv, &pba_tlv_len,
+					ICE_SR_PBA_BLOCK_PTR);
+	if (status) {
+		ice_debug(hw, ICE_DBG_INIT, "Failed to read PBA Block TLV.\n");
+		return status;
+	}
+
+	/* pba_size is the next word */
+	status = ice_read_sr_word(hw, (pba_tlv + 2), &pba_size);
+	if (status) {
+		ice_debug(hw, ICE_DBG_INIT, "Failed to read PBA Section size.\n");
+		return status;
+	}
+
+	if (pba_tlv_len < pba_size) {
+		ice_debug(hw, ICE_DBG_INIT, "Invalid PBA Block TLV size.\n");
+		return ICE_ERR_INVAL_SIZE;
+	}
+
+	/* Subtract one to get PBA word count (PBA Size word is included in
+	 * total size)
+	 */
+	pba_size--;
+	if (pba_num_size < (((u32)pba_size * 2) + 1)) {
+		ice_debug(hw, ICE_DBG_INIT,
+			  "Buffer too small for PBA data.\n");
+		return ICE_ERR_PARAM;
+	}
+
+	for (i = 0; i < pba_size; i++) {
+		status = ice_read_sr_word(hw, (pba_tlv + 2 + 1) + i, &pba_word);
+		if (status) {
+			ice_debug(hw, ICE_DBG_INIT,
+				  "Failed to read PBA Block word %d.\n", i);
+			return status;
+		}
+
+		pba_num[(i * 2)] = (pba_word >> 8) & 0xFF;
+		pba_num[(i * 2) + 1] = pba_word & 0xFF;
+	}
+	pba_num[(pba_size * 2)] = '\0';
+
+	return status;
+}
